PEGGY LEE - Songs

A highly acclaimed jazz singer with a sultry style, Peggy Lee's long and distinguished career dates from 1936 when she started singing at around age 10 with Jack Wardlow. Her long string of hits from 1945-1969 include "Mr. Wonderful" (1956), "Fever" (1958), and "Is That All There Is" (1969).
